Where is the best place to put a moisture trap?

- Place your absorber closest to the sources of humidity. - Place it in a discreet location, for example under an item of furniture. - Avoid placing it near doors and windows where it would work unnecessarily on absorbing moisture from the outside.

Subsequently, question is, are moisture traps any good? In short they do work but only in certain areas and they certainly wouldn't match the quality of a conventional dehumidifier. However, they do have their uses and are useful for reducing moisture and damp in confined areas like cupboards.

How long does it take for DampRid to start working?

DampRid Moisture Absorbers work in three phases: It may take a few days before liquid begins to drip. Accumulated moisture will drip into the bottom chamber, and about half to three-quarters of the crystals will dissolve. All of the DampRid crystals will dissolve and the bottom chamber will be full of liquid.

Is DampRid safe to breathe?

Safety of Damprid. DampRid is a household product that prevents mold and mildew development by absorbing excess moisture in the air. The active ingredient in DampRid, calcium chloride, is considered nontoxic and does not emit noxious gases or fumes.

Is Rice a good moisture absorber?

Before it is cooked, dried rice has the capacity to absorb a good deal of moisture, making it useful as a food-safe desiccant. By making breathable pouches for your dried rice, you can enjoy the drying benefits of rice without the mess of loose rice strands. Rice has practical, as well as food, applications.

Does salt absorb moisture in the air?

Salt absorbs water moisture because it is an ionic compound with strong attractive forces for the highly polar water molecules. This property means that salt is hygroscopic, meaning that it absorbs both liquid water and water vapor in the air.

Why are my house windows wet inside?

Interior window condensation is caused by excessive moisture in the house, and it often occurs in the winter when the warm air inside the house condenses on the cold windows. Condensation between window panes occurs when the seal between the panes is broken or when the desiccant inside the windows is saturated.

What absorbs moisture in a car?

Keep a container of baking soda in your car to absorb moisture. Fill a small container with baking soda. Put it on one of the floors of your car to continuously absorb moisture. Check the container every few days and replace the baking soda when it gets damp.
